Anti-Tumor Drug Market Size to Reach USD 286.4 Billion by 2032 | Key Trends & Forecasts
Anti-tumor drug market is entering a period of accelerated transformation, driven by rising cancer incidence, rapid advancements in immuno-oncology, and the increasing integration of precision medicine. Valued at USD 167.5 billion in 2024, the market is projected to reach USD 286.4 billion by 2032, expanding at a CAGR of 6.1%. Fueled by biologics, targeted therapies, and next-generation immunotherapies, the sector continues to attract significant investments from global pharmaceutical innovators and healthcare policymakers.

Key Market Drivers
Rising Global Cancer Burden
With 20 million new cancer cases reported annually, demand for effective anti-tumor therapies continues to surge across all major healthcare markets.
Adoption of Personalized Medicine
Targeted therapy drugs dominate the market due to their superior efficacy and reduced toxicity profiles. Precision oncology tools such as biomarker testing and companion diagnostics are enabling more targeted treatment decisions.
Growth of Immunotherapies
Immune checkpoint inhibitors and CAR-T cell therapies represent the fastest-growing category, supported by expanding clinical trial pipelines and increasing regulatory approvals.
Technological Integration in Drug Development
AI-driven drug discovery platforms are significantly shortening development cycles, allowing pharmaceutical companies to accelerate pipeline progression and improve candidate success rates.

Segment Insights & Regional Overview
By Type
Targeted therapy drugs remain the leading segment, with strong adoption of tyrosine kinase inhibitors and monoclonal antibodies. Immunotherapy drugs continue gaining momentum as clinical outcomes improve across multiple cancer types.
By Application
Lung cancer dominates the global application segment due to rising incidence rates and significant advancements in targeted and immune-based treatments.

By Mechanism of Action
Small molecule inhibitors represent a rapidly growing segment, supported by higher bioavailability, oral administration convenience, and expanding therapeutic indications.
By Distribution Channel
Hospital pharmacies hold the largest share, driven by in-patient treatment requirements for advanced cancer therapies and specialized medication handling.
Regional Overview
North America leads the global market, supported by robust healthcare infrastructure, rapid adoption of biologics, and strong oncology-focused R&D ecosystems.
Asia-Pacific is emerging as a high-growth region driven by expanding cancer screening programs, improving healthcare access, and rising investments from regional governments and multinational drug manufacturers.
